Something’s Not Right About The Lou Williams Robbery Story

What did you think of the story Lou Williams told Bob Cooney of the Philly.com the other night.  Williams says he had a gun pulled on him by a would-be-robber, who upon recognizing who he was reconsidered robbing him because of the guard’s community work. I can vouch for Williams’ community work, but to think that the guy didn’t rob him because of it, is a stretch for me.

Here’s how Williams recalled it.

“A guy tried to rob me but decided not to because of whatever I do in the community,” said Williams a couple of nights ago. “He’s a Lou Williams fan so he didn’t rob me.”

“There’s crime everywhere,” said Williams. “I was debating whether to pull off or help the guy. The gun was already out. He did all the talking and we came up with a solution before I could really say much. I treated him to McDonald’s.”

There’s no way I would have taken the guy to McDonald’s.  I couldn’t forget the fact that the guy had just pulled a gun on me.  While sitting there at the McDonald’s he might reconsider and decide to rob me again.  He might decide to rob the McDonald’s.

Am I supposed to reason from this story that the guy had pulled the gun on Williams because he needed something to eat?  Is this guy going to continue being the “stick-em-up man”?

I don’t totally buy this story. Did Williams report the robbery attempt to the police?  Are we supposed to see the robber as a good guy?

What about you guys?  Would you have reacted like Williams and treated the guy to something to eat at McDonald’s?
